🙂A single person spends $713 per month in Hato Mayor del Rey vs $1,197 in Tbilisi, rent included.
🙂A couple spends around $1,139 per month in Hato Mayor del Rey vs $1,868 in Tbilisi, rent included.
🙂A family of three spends $1,565 per month in Hato Mayor del Rey vs $2,538 in Tbilisi, rent included.
🙂Hato Mayor del Rey is about 40% cheaper than Tbilisi,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Both Hato Mayor del Rey and Tbilisi are more affordable than the global median – Hato Mayor del Rey47% lower, Tbilisi10% lower.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$143 in Hato Mayor del Rey versus $687 in Tbilisi.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$27.00 in Hato Mayor del Rey versus $44.00 in Tbilisi. Groceries tell a different story – $251 in Hato Mayor del Rey vs $205 in Tbilisi – so Tbilisi wins on supermarket bills even if dining out costs more.
